      I saw the fight last night with Canelo and think he lacked movement and volume of punches thrown. Canelo was a better fighter at 154lbs and 160lbs when he was lighter. The added weight with his small frame hasn't helped him especially as he aged. With the low volume of punches that Canelo thrown last night, if he were to fight Bivol, he would lose easily. Bivol has much much better movement and boxing fundamentals than Canelo. Canelo likes to throw hard punches to his opponent's arms and wear them down so they can't lift their arms as the fight progresses. This strategy didn't work with Bivol and it costed him the fight. To beat Bivol, he would need good movement, jab more, stick and move and be elusive. This isn't how Canelo fights. Bivol will jab Canelo hard, use good ring movement, box and take the fight into the late rounds and he could possibly stop Canelo. Canelo has this belief in his power that he could just hit people a few times and they do down. In lighter weight divisions he could get away with that but guys at 168lbs and 175lbs not so much. Canelo has a better frame for a 154 or 160lb fighter not 168 or 175lbs. Beating Kovalev at 175lbs years ago who was wayyy past his best gave him misguided self belief in his power.

      I think Canelo is still a good fighter but needs to drop down to 154 or 160lbs which would do a lot for his conditioning which could help him more as he ages.
